Please use this identifier to cite or link to this item: https://cuir.car.chula.ac.th/handle/123456789/2202
Title: รายงานผลการวิจัยและพัฒนาโครงการหลัก การพัฒนาวงจรอิเล็กทรอนิกส์เพื่ออุตสาหกรรม, โครงการย่อย เครื่องควบคุมที่โปรแกรมได้ชนิดที่มีความสามารถด้านจัดการข้อมูล
Other Titles: เครื่องควบคุมที่โปรแกรมได้ชนิดที่มีความสามารถด้านจัดการข้อมูล
เครื่องควบคุมที่โปรแกรมได้ชนิดที่มีความสามารถด้านจัดการข้อมูล
Programmable controller with data handling capability
Authors: กฤษดา วิศวธีรานนท์
สมบูรณ์ จงชัยกิจ
สิทธิพร ประวัติรุ่งเรือง
Email: Krisada.V@chula.ac.th
feescc@kankrow.eng.chula.ac.th
Other author: จุฬาลงกรณ์มหาวิทยาลัย. ภาควิชาวิศวกรรมไฟฟ้า
จุฬาลงกรณ์มหาวิทยาลัย. ภาควิชาวิศวกรรมไฟฟ้า
จุฬาลงกรณ์มหาวิทยาลัย. ภาควิชาวิศวกรรมไฟฟ้า
Subjects: เครื่องควบคุมแบบโปรแกรม
Issue Date: 2533
Publisher: จุฬาลงกรณ์มหาวิทยาลัย
Abstract: รายงานนี้กล่าวถึง การออกแบบเครื่องควบคุมชนิดโปรแกรมได้ซึ่งมีความสามารถทางด้านการจัดการข้อมูล ผู้ใช้สามารถกำหนดขนาดและชนิดของอินพุท/เอาท์พุทตามความเหมาะสมของงานได้ มีโครงสร้างของระบบเป็นโมดูล สามารถต่ออินพุท/เอาท์พุทได้สูงสุด 512 จุด สามารถรับสัญญาณอินพุทแบบอนาลอกได้ ตัวป้อนโปรแกรมเป็นแบบมือถิอแสดงผลโดย LCD การเขียนโปรแกรมควบคุมเป็นแบบโปรแกรมขั้นบันได้ (Ladder) และฟังก์ชั่นบล็อก (Function block) มีคำสั่งทั้งสิ้น 64 คำสั่ง และมีคำสั่งในการจัดข้อมูลต่าง ๆ ด้วย ความเร็วในการทำงานของคำสั่งเบื้องต้นประมาณ 5.7 โมลาร์เซค ผู้ใช้สามารถเขียนโปรแกรมควบคุมได้สูงสุดประมาณ 4000 คำสั่ง การแปลงคำสั่งขั้นบันไดเป็นแบบผสมระหว่างวิธีคอมพายล์ (Complie) และวิธีคอล (Call) และมีความเร็วในการทำงานแต่ละรอบ (Scan time) น้อยกว่า 100 mesec ผลการทดสอบเป็นที่น่าพอใจสามารถใช้เป็นต้นแบบผลิตภัณฑ์ได้
Other Abstract: This report presents a development of programmable controller with data ghandling capability. The number and type of input/output can be easily chosen by the user due to its modular structure. The controller can handle up to 512 input/output points which include analog input. The programming console is hand-held one with LCD display. The programming language is based on ladder diagram and function block. There are 64 instructions which include data handling ones. The average execution time of basic instruction is about 5.7 molarsex. The user can program up to 4000 steps with scan time less than 100 msec. The user program interpretation is based on compiler and call technique. The tests are quite satisfactory and can be adapted as industrial prototype.
URI: http://cuir.car.chula.ac.th/handle/123456789/2202
Type: Technical Report
Appears in Collections:Eng - Research Reports

Files in This Item:
File Description SizeFormat 
Krisada(ind).pdf24.22 MBAdobe PDFView/Open


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.